What is the Industrial Revolution?
Technological development is to change the political, social, and cultural structures along with changes in the industrial economic structure.
Let's take a look at all the industrial revolutions we've had
1st Industrial Revolution: "Machine Revolution"
- It occurred in Europe and the United States during the 18th-19th century and the transformation of rural communities into urban industrial societies
- Steel and textile industries develop with the invention of steam engine
2nd Industrial Revolution: "Energy Revolution"
- Started between 1870-1914 and using steel, oil, and electricity to secure large-scale energy sources
- Key technologies - telephones, bulbs, electrical shafts, internal combustion engines, etc
3rd Industrial Revolution: "Digital Revolution"
- Means Analog Electromechanical Devices Evolving to Digital Devices
- Key technologies - personal computers, the Internet, information and communication technology, etc
Fourth Industrial Revolution: "Super-Connection, Super-Intelligence and Convergence Revolution"
- New technologies such as artificial intelligence, big data, and the Internet of Things based on technologies built by the digital revolution
- Building a virtual physical system that integrates real and virtual to automatically and intelligently control things
Let's look at the characteristics of the Fourth Industrial Revolution
Key technologies at the heart of the Fourth Industrial Revolution - artificial intelligence, robots, the Internet of Things, autonomous vehicles, three-dimensional printing, nanotechnology, biotechnology, etc
Among these technologies, artificial intelligence is the core technology of the Fourth Industrial Revolution and the most central one is artificial intelligence
- AI refers to the intelligence created by machines, whose purpose is to enable machines to imitate human intelligence capabilities, such as cognition, reasoning, and learning
Recently, intensive investment, research, and development by major countries around the world and leading global intellectual property companies such as Google, Facebook, and Amazon are taking place in the AI field.
The spread of artificial intelligence technology is currently rapidly increasing, and it has a wide impact on social and cultural fields as well as traditional economic industries such as finance and medical care.

With the development of artificial intelligence, interest in future job prospects is also increasing
In the case of Arbeit 4.0 in Germany, employment changes were predicted as follows.
Organize business processes more effectively, efficiently, and enable real-time control through digital media and intelligent tools
Flexible working hours, places of work, low hierarchical order, etc: make labor processors flexible and eliminate the boundary between working hours and personal hours
Intermediate-level administrative service activities, excluding highly skilled tasks, are automated
There are jobs that are lost due to technology development, but there are also new jobs that are created through this
ex) High level of expertise, including data analysts and robot experts
As mentioned earlier, as corporate functions are applied without boundaries between industries through the platform, it is expected that work will also be converted to functional expertise and spread non-typical employment types

Artificial Intelligence
Origins of Artificial Intelligence
- The term "AI" is used by Professor John McCarthy of Dartmouth as the term (AI) proposed at the Dartmouth Conference is adopted
- According to Professor John McCarthy, AI is the science and engineering that produces intelligent machines, especially intelligent computer programs

In this figure, it can be seen that AI has changed to basic AI, machine learning, and deep learning
Machine learning is a part of AI and aims to develop predictive engines for certain cases.
(includes more than 15 major algorithms in total)
- Among them, deep learning algorithms are currently a breakthrough in the field of AI
- Existing machine learning algorithms showed excellent performance in solving problems in specific fields, but were very difficult when applied in various environments
Use of Deep Learning Algorithms
- Object recognition in the image
- real-time translation
- Controlling Devices with Voice
- Tumor detection in medical images
Among these technologies, "object recognition in images" and "tumor detection in medical images" are technologies derived from image processing.

My thoughts on AI job replacement
There are many speculations that the position of a teacher will be replaced by artificial intelligence. In education, I think it is a groundbreaking technology to develop more accurate information delivery and self-directed learning skills through artificial intelligence. However, this artificial intelligence technology is just a teacher as a 'knowledge carrier'. The role of the teacher varies. It teaches children knowledge and changes their lives. Therefore, teachers should consider creativity, empathy, and communication skills more important than teaching knowledge to children from the present and make efforts to develop them. I think that if the role of a teacher changes from simple "teaching" to "coaching", the role of a teacher will not be replaced by artificial intelligence.
